The conductor has reboarded the 5302 after doing a roll-by inspection of a westbound freight. Now his train is departing with a north of the border unit as its companion. The train itself was a mix of tank cars and covered hoppers. What symbol was this train?
Date: 11/12/2011 Location: Wayzata, MN   Map Show Wayzata on a rail map Views: 315 Collection Of:   Tony Held
Locomotives: BNSF 5302(C44-9W) TFM 1633(SD70MAC)    Author:  Richard Held
